Tnakan is an online marketplace designed to facilitate direct sales between farmers and consumers. The platform features categorized sections for products such as meat, dairy items, bread, and spices.

Operating through its website, Tnakan offers a range of goods sourced from local farmers. Customers can choose to pay either online or in cash upon delivery. The marketplace is available in Armenian and English languages.

Tnakan’s target consumers are those who prefer natural products and seek goods sourced directly from local farmers. The platform is designed to facilitate access to such products through its online marketplace.

Tnakan is a free online marketplace that enables customers to order products such as meat, dairy items, fresh fruits, and vegetables directly from farms. The platform facilitates delivery within a few hours and offers payment options either online or upon delivery.

Tnakan facilitates connections between farmers and end consumers by improving market access. The platform enables direct sales of products described as natural and of quality, supporting a model that emphasizes producer-to-consumer interaction without intermediaries.
